Fani-Kayode blasts Osinbajo for not attending ECOWAS Heads of State meeting

Former Aviation Minister, Femi Fani-Kayode has lashed out at Acting President Yemi Osinbajo, for not attending the 51st ECOWAS Summit of Heads of State and Government, which took place on Saturday.


The summit was held in Liberia’s capital, Monrovia, with Israeli Prime Minister, Benjamin Netanyahu, in attendance.
Netanyahu is the first non-African leader invited to address the ECOWAS leaders.

There has been no official statement from Nigeria’s presidency, as to why the country was not represented at the meeting.

“It is wrong that @ProfOsinbajo did not attend the ECOWAS Heads of State meeting with @netanyahu today. Nigeria not there. Sad and shameful,” Fani-Kayode tweeted.

Former president Olusegun Obasanjo was, however, in attendance. It was not certain if he was there to represent Nigeria.
